The mentoring process is about what is right or what is wrong, and learning to do what is right:

- Dealing with the challenge of what is right to do
- Doing the right thing - regardless of "who is right" but rather "what is right"
- Managing competing rights
- The role of senior management in setting the ethical agenda
- Key factors in ethical success or ethical meltdown of a business organization
- Ethical 'blind-spots' that are sources of organizational missteps

The role of executive leaders in determining ethical organizational behavior is critical to the success of such an essential daily issue.

Additionally, it is about avoiding the common pitfalls that are all too easy to fall into. Thoughts such as:

- Everyone else does it...
- They will never miss it...
- Nobody will care...
- No one will know...
- Its not my job...
